Essential Food Handler Training for Ontario Professionals

In Ontario, upholding food safety standards is paramount. Every food handler, whether working in a restaurant, food service establishment, or another food-related setting, must receive essential food handler training. This thorough course equips workers with the knowledge to handle food safely and prevent outbreaks. Ontario's training requirements require that food handlers comprehend key principles such as proper handwashing, safe handling temperatures, and the avoidance of cross-contamination.
